Abstract

In this paper, we consider the problem of analyzing data flow programs with the property that actor production and consumption rates are not constant and fixed, but limited by intervals. Such interval ranges may result from uncertainty in the specification of an actor or as a design freedom of the model. Major questions such as consistency and buffer memory requirements for single-processor schedules will be analyzed here for such specifications for the first time. © Springer-Verlag Berlin Heidelberg 2004.
